Product details

LY BGA Rework Machine M700 Reball Machine Reballing Oven 220V 200W with Temperature Adjust Manual Control

The LY BGA Rework Machine M700 is a manual-operated reballing oven designed for precise BGA (Ball Grid Array) component rework. Built with a durable plastic chassis and stainless steel heating element, it delivers temperature-adjustable manual control for consistent soldering performance. Certified to CE standards, it supports MIG welding processes and operates at 220V with 200W input power.
